— FROM DRUM TO DÉCOR

How a discarded oil drum becomes art

The steel drum art tradition began in Haiti's Croix-des-Bouquets and lives on in every piece we sell.

01

Rescue

Used 55-gallon oil drums are collected and cleaned — nothing new is mined or manufactured.

02

Flatten

The drum is burned to strip residue, then hammered flat into a single wide sheet of steel.

03

Cut

A design is chalked freehand, then chiseled and shear-cut entirely by hand — no two edges are identical.

04

Finish

Edges are smoothed, details are tooled, and the piece is sealed to protect its story for a lifetime.

The Sound of Steel: How Haiti's Recycled Drums Become Art
Craftsmanship 1 min read · July 2026

The Sound of Steel: How Haiti's Recycled Drums Become Art

In the town of Croix-des-Bouquets, just outside Port-au-Prince, the sound of hammer on steel has rung out since the 1950s. What began as one blacksmith reshaping a discarded oil drum into a cross for a local cemetery grew into an entire art form — and today, it's the heartbeat of everything we make. A steel drum is never "just metal" to the artisans we work with. Before it becomes a wall hanging or a pendant, it's rescued from a scrapyard, burned clean, and beaten flat by hand until it becomes a single, unbroken sheet — a blank canvas with its own history still visible in every dent.
